MoU exchange with Beijing Jiaotong University

UTAR cordially welcomed delegates from Beijing Jiaotong University to the UTAR Sungai Long Campus on 12 January 2017. The purpose of the visit was to exchange MoU documents which were already signed in advance and promote mutual understanding between both institutions.

The delegates from Beijing Jiaotong University were Vice President Prof Dr Chen Feng, School of Civil Engineering Vice Dean Prof Dr Gao Liang, Office of Research Director Prof Dr Jing Tao, Office of International Affairs Deputy Director Lyu Chao, and National Rail Traffic Technical Education and Service Center Deputy Director Wang Gang.

Welcoming them were UTAR Vice President for Internationalisation and Academic Development Prof Ir Dr Ewe Hong Tat, Division of Community and International Networking Prof Dr Cheng Ming Yu, Lee Kong Chian Faculty of Engineering and Science Dean Prof Ir Dr Goi Bok Min, Faculty of Accountancy and Management (FAM) Dean Dr Sia Bee Chuan, Institute of Chinese Studies Dean Assoc Prof Dr Chong Siou Wei, Centre for Extension Education Director Lim Guat Yen, Faculty of Creative Industries Department of Mass Communication Head Dr Lim Chai Lee, and FAM Lecturer Dr Ma Guoxin.

The meeting commenced with a presentation of the UTAR corporate video and Prof Ewe’s welcoming address. Prof Ewe expressed his warmest welcome and gratitude to the visitors and looked forward to closer collaboration with Beijing Jiaotong University in future. He said, “UTAR will actively develop any possible collaboration with Beijing Jiaotong University as soon as possible to benefit more students. We just recently received sponsorship from the Malaysian Association in the People’s Republic of China (MAPROC) to facilitate our students in exchange programmes, internships and study tours to China. I believe today’s MoU with Beijing Jiaotong University will enable our students to gain more exposure to new knowledge, broaden their global perspectives and learn from international peers.”

Prof Chen remarked, “Beijing Jiaotong University visits foreign institutions every year and I am glad to say that today’s visit is the first visit for us in 2017. This will be a fruitful visit because we exchange our MoU documents today which is a step towards bringing more benefits to both universities’ students. Beijing Jiaotong University is an old university in China and there are huge numbers of our graduates supporting the transport industry in China. I hope we are able to exploit the strengths of each university to develop the best possible collaboration for our students.”

The MoU exchange ceremony wrapped up with an exchange of souvenirs and a group photo session.
